School Overview
Cedar Grove High School, located in Ellenwood, Georgia, serves the DeKalb County School District and is well-regarded for its strong sense of community and competitive extracurricular programs. The school offers a comprehensive academic curriculum designed to prepare students for post-secondary success, supported by a faculty committed to fostering both intellectual growth and character development. As a cornerstone of the Ellenwood area, the institution emphasizes a supportive environment where students are encouraged to engage in a variety of clubs, organizations, and academic pathways.
Beyond the classroom, Cedar Grove High School is perhaps most notably recognized for its storied athletic tradition, particularly its highly successful football program, which has garnered state-wide attention and multiple championship titles. This spirit of excellence extends into other areas of school life, including arts and vocational programs, which help to provide a well-rounded educational experience. By balancing rigorous academic standards with robust student involvement, Cedar Grove continues to be a vital hub for youth development and community pride in the DeKalb County region.
